Mission
What you will drive
Strategic channel optimisation
- Support marketers with your channel expertise to design and deliver multi-touchpoint marketing campaigns across digital channels such as website, email, social media and paid media/search.
- Craft customer journey's which nurture new or existing prospects across the marketing funnel, increasing awareness of ERM in the marketing, encouraging engagement with marketing campaigns and with a particular focus on conversion rate optimisation.
- Build personalisation into digital channels, using both demographic and behavioural indicators of segmented audiences to improve engagement.
- Confidently leverage marketing automation and CRM data and functionality to drive more informed channel improvements.
- Leverage analytics and data to share insights to guide channel strategies.
- Support campaign teams in meeting KPIs including channel specific goals, as well as commercial lead generation to positively influence revenue generation.
Paid Media Strategy & Performance
- Own the paid media strategy across channels (search, social, display, programmatic).
- Innovate and establish ERM's digital media approach across brand awareness/equity benefits in addition to direct lead generation efforts on this channel.
- Set performance targets and KPIs, monitor results, and optimize spend.
- Manage relationships with UK-based media agencies, ensuring alignment with strategy and accountability for performance.
- Lead quarterly reviews and performance deep-dives with agency partners.
Website Optimization
- Oversee website performance, including traffic, conversion rates, and user experience.
- Collaborate with UX, analytics, and development teams to implement improvements.
- Lead the strategic improvements of the corporate website to increase the commercial performance. Leverage SEO guidance, UX best practise and optimised content to drive more people to ERM.com and convert a higher proportion of traffic to leads.
- Manage UK-based web agency to deliver strategic optimisation project and resolve business as usual issues.
Team & Performance Management
- Manage a team of 3 digital marketing professionals focused specifically on website, paid media and UX design/development.
- Support the team to achieve individual and team KPIs; conduct regular reviews and feedback sessions.
- Embody the team's collaborative, high-performing culture.
- Identify skill gaps and implement training/upskilling initiatives.
Operational Excellence & Standardization
- Establish and maintain standardized processes, workflows, and documentation (SOPs).
- Monitor campaign delivery timelines, quality standards, and performance metrics.
- Drive best-in-class execution across all digital marketing outputs including campaign assets, reports, automations, and performance dashboards.
Marketing Systems & Data Enablement
- Ensure consistent usage and optimization of platforms like Optimizely (CMS), Salesforce, Pardot (Marketing Cloud Account Engagement), Ad platforms such as Google, Bing, Microsoft and social media platforms.
- Review and improve lead funnel management practices in alignment with commercial goals.
- Build dashboards and reports to track channel performance.
- Provide actionable insights to internal stakeholders and agency partners.
- Stay current on digital trends, tools, and benchmarks.

About
Inside Environmental Resources Management
ERM is a leading global sustainability consulting firm, committed for nearly 50 years to helping organizations navigate complex environmental, social, and governance (ESG) challenges. The organization brings together a diverse and inclusive community of experts across regions and disciplines to drive sustainable impact for clients and the planet.
